Enjoy a weekend at Mont Tremblant in January. With consistent snowfall, well-groomed trails, it’s the perfect time to hit the slopes or nearby cross country trails.
Beyond the slopes, the pedestrian village adds to the charm with cozy cafés, festive lights, and a lively après-ski atmosphere. January is peak season, so you’ll find plenty of energy in the air.

Nordic skiers can head to the National Park du Mont Tremblant on Saturday by coach and explore the 43km of mechanically groomed trails for cross-country skiing with rustic wood-heated shacks along the way. Keep and eye out for deer and other wildlife along the trails
Sunday venture out from the resort on the Nordic trails from Mont-Tremblant village (accessible for intermediate and advanced skiers)on La Villageoise-de-Mont-Tremblant trail near the P2 lot. Or you may choose to return to National Park du Mont Tremblant (finding your own way) and continue enjoyingthe 43 km of groomed trails. (Trail passes can be puchased locally)
